About В. П. Утробин
В. П. Утробин is a scholar working on Astronomy and Astrophysics, Nuclear and High Energy Physics, Instrumentation, Aerospace Engineering and Pulmonary and Respiratory Medicine, having authored 49 papers that have together received 638 indexed citations. Recurring topics across this work include Gamma-ray bursts and supernovae (45 papers), Pulsars and Gravitational Waves Research (15 papers), Astro and Planetary Science (14 papers), Astrophysics and Cosmic Phenomena (12 papers), Astrophysical Phenomena and Observations (11 papers), Stellar, planetary, and galactic studies (7 papers), Neutrino Physics Research (6 papers) and Astronomy and Astrophysical Research (4 papers). The work is most often cited by research in Astronomy and Astrophysics (625 citations), Nuclear and High Energy Physics (255 citations), Instrumentation (43 citations), Geophysics (12 citations) and Radiation (7 citations). В. П. Утробин has collaborated with scholars based in Russia, Germany and United States. Frequent co-authors include Н. Н. Чугай, A. Wongwathanarat, Ewald Müller, Athira Menon, Alexander Heger, Hans‐Thomas Janka, Thomas Ertl, В. С. Имшенник, D. K. Nadyozhin and A. Pastorello. Their work appears in journals such as Monthly Notices of the Royal Astronomical Society, Astronomy and Astrophysics, Monthly Notices of the Royal Astronomical Society Letters, Physics-Uspekhi and The Astrophysical Journal Letters.
